A company called SPARCOM (I don't have their number, but their in Corvallis, Oregon and directory assistance should be able to get it for you) has a ROM card called the Personal Information Manager (PIM), which has all those programs in it. It can also be ordered from EduCALC (probably at a lower price than direct from SPARCOM). There are of course, a bunch of free programs available on the net as well (most available from the ftp archive sites or Wayne's mail server). John
